Senator Alli’s contributions to good governance earn Prestigious Senate Press Award

Senator Sharafadeen Alli (APC- Oyo South), the Senate Committee Chairman on INEC, would on Monday be honoured with the prestigious award of “Responsive Representation for Good Governance” by the Senate Press Corps.

This is contained in a statement signed by his Special Adviser on Media, Akeem Abas and made available to newsmen.

The Senate Press Corps in its separate letters dated November 19 and December 10, said the award was in recognition of his outstanding contributions to good governance and responsive legislative representation.

The award, according to the Senate Press Corps, is a testament to the Senator’s dedication to transparency, accountability, and good governance.

The conferment ceremony is scheduled to take place at the Nnamdi Azikiwe Hall of Nicon Luxury Hotel, Abuja, on Monday, December 16.

Senator Alli has expressed gratitude to the Senate Press Corps for acknowledging his efforts in advancing the welfare of his constituents and promoting democratic values through effective representation.

“I appreciate the Senate Press Corps for this recognition and invites all stakeholders to join him at the event,” he said.

Alli, a firm believer in servant leadership, has consistently demonstrated commitment to the growth and development of Oyo South Senatorial District and it’s inhabitants.

The lawmaker reiterated his commitment to serving the people of Oyo South as well as Nigeria with renewed vigour and determination.

His legislative initiatives and constituency interventions have significantly impacted various sectors, including education, health care, infrastructure, rural development and food security.

This award underscored the senator’s efforts in ensuring that the principles of democracy are upheld in the legislative process, particularly in his role as Senate Committee Chairman on Electoral Matters.
